The interior of a deserted factory near Vilnius was re-born in an American, rustic style. The modern, yet striking loft works as a home and studio as well.

The iron columns and structure proved to be irremovable, while the floor could be lowered downwards. This way at the section under the windows sofas and a low coffee table were placed. The patterned, bohemian pieces can be opened into beds, while the top of the table was transformed from the piece of a Cretan house’s wooden door.

The dining harmonizing with the living room occupies one of the spaces under the gallery. The chairs and the wooden table are also from Crete. The bright, natural brown shades are stir up by the vibration of the bookshelf.

The restoration of the iron columns was a big task, but in this way has been managed to give back/reflect the atmosphere of the American warehouses that were built at the turn of the century. The ash wood stairs that lead upstairs occupy little space, the lower steps work as storage as well.

There is a relatively darker bar under the mezzanine. The black wall used as a board gives depth to the space, while the light green and white furniture do not allow the too much darkening of the furnishings’ atmosphere/mood.

The rest of the ground floor works as a studio. Beside a comfortable, spacious desk a wall clock is adorning that was made from the piece of an old wrought iron fence of a Vilnius street.

The two bathrooms are over each other. The simpler, white shaded room is followed by a shower that shines in red color.

The bedroom that stands on the gallery it counterpoints the below crowdedness. Here everything wishes to highlight the contrast of the white brick walls and brown wooden floor. It is calm and slow.

A hidden office as well was placed in the corner. It is full of life, creative snug, where antiquities are inspiring for creation.

It is a brilliant, functional interior in such a building that at the same time evokes the industrial revolution and offers modern comfort.
